Could someone help me work out a diet plan? I know I should be eating about 6 small meals a day, I just don't know what times I should be having them at so they're spaced out enough.

I get up at about 10am and go to bed at about 1am, now should I be fasting after a certain time or what? Please, any help will really be appreciated. smile

Hm, try...

10am - breakfast

1pm - small lunch

3pm - small snack meal

6pm - dinner

8pm - last snack meal

I know that's only about five, but it means you can fast after 8pm and since you're only getting up at 10am it means there's less hours in the day for you to seperate out the meals.

It wouldnt necessarily make your food intake different......i just want my protein shake to be my meal, 2 hours before I touch the weights as it is easier on the body to breakdown, so I alternate the whole meal and protein shakes accordingly to fit my workout schedule for the day


i wouldnt necessarily say protein shakes will speed up weight loss (as protein >>> carbs)

As you have to remember: the diet plan needs to compliment the workout plan and vice versa
